  • Rosenthal Porcelain Figurine of a Huddling Penguin Pair
    By Rosenthal
    Located in Philadelphia, PA
    A fine mid-century Rosenthal porcelain figurine. In the form of a pair of penguins huddling together with one another. Entitled "Pinguinpaar" (Penguin Pair), design no. 693. Designed by Karl Himmelstoss for Rosenthal. Marked to the base with a green Rosenthal maker's mark, two old Rosenthal labels, an A.S. Cooper & Sons Bermuda retail label. There is an impressed mark beneath one of the Rosenthal labels which is likely H.693 for the model number. Simply a wonderful Rosenthal penguin...
